Minimum requirements
| CPU | Core 2 Quad equivalent or better |
|---|---|
| GPU | DirectX 11 compatible (GTX 400 series or later/AMD HD 6xxx or later) |
| RAM | 4 GB |
| Storage | 20 GB HDD |
| DirectX | Version 11 |
Recommended requirements
| RAM | 8 GB |
|---|---|
| Storage | 20 GB HDD |
| DirectX | Version 11 |
